Why Are Customs Rules So Complicated?

Each individual country must look after the needs of its citizens, and international trade can be extremely impactful to national economies. Balanced correctly, imports and exports are of huge benefit to nations, but that balance is complex and difficult, requiring fine-tuning that is often goods specific. This means there is no simple ‘one size fits all’ solution, as each country has its own list of import tariffs, restricted items, and individual paperwork that must be completed to meet its requirements.

Global trade standards are in place to smooth this process as much as possible, with over 98% of the world adhering to useful trade systems such as the HS (Harmonised System) Code that streamlines international custom through clear codes for goods identification, but even that can seem difficult and complex for anyone not used to dealing with it on a daily basis.

What Does a Freight Forwarder Do?

Freight forwarders like us oversee the complete shipping process. Included in that brief is the need to manage the complexities of different countries’ customs regulations, releasing the burden of complex paperwork from our customers’ shoulders.

Our expert team has years of experience in meeting international compliance rules, with established relationships with customs authorities and partners around the world. For you, this leads to behind-the-scenes efficiency. Our team deals with the vast majority of customs requirements without any need for you to become involved.

We simplify the whole process:

  • Ensuring customs paperwork is accurately prepared, with the experience to know what’s required and in what format, no matter the destination country.
  • Avoiding delays and fines by ensuring everything is in order before shipping, to facilitate smooth customs clearance.
  • Managing duties and taxes so you don’t have to. The customs compliance costs are calculated in advance and folded into the overall price of shipping, so you can budget for them appropriately. Plus, they’re broken down clearly so you can see what you’re paying and where.
  • Staying up to date with regulation changes, no matter how frequent!
